Who is Thor in Magnus chase?

Thor (From ON: Þórr, “thunder”, often spelled Tor) is the Norse Æsir god of thunder, strength, fertility, and consecration, and is physically the strongest of the Æsir. The son of Odin and Jörð, he is married to the goddess Sif. He was known as Thunor to the Anglo-Saxons, and Donar to the southern Germanic peoples.

Who is the assassin in the Hammer of Thor?

Magnus and his friends are running out of time to find the hammer and prevent Sam’s wedding to Thrym, so they ask a god named Heimdall to help them locate the assassin that warned Magnus against going to the wight’s tomb. They discover that he is a giant named Utgard-Loki.

Is Percy Jackson in Trials of Apollo?

Yes, Percy does appear in Trials of Apollo. He appears near the beginning of The Hidden Oracle, where he gives Apollo and Meg a ride to Camp Half Blood, fighting some Nosoi along the way. He also appears near the end of the book, where he helps with the fight against the Colossus.

Who is Thor in Norse mythology?

The son of Odin and Jörð, he is married to the goddess Sif. He was known as Thunor to the Anglo-Saxons, and Donar to the southern Germanic peoples. His symbols of power include the lightning bolt, hammer, axe, and club, goats, and oak trees. Thor was born to Odin and the Jötunn Jörð, the Earth herself.
